Type
ORACLE
Validation date
2023-10-14 08: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03486,
    "usd": 0.03779
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000199703293EC21E543E6BE8B39D696EB154FAC47B367FF571C4116224F17D97C23

Previous signature

72D73EAF7DAD10AB9729BF176523788D5A7C14DA157AB341840074BA6AE9B2B46C4B2A1EE879E70AC2B62D7D450B187C4C937101A526A8ACAFDD4C30794A2D0E

Origin signature

304502205F4A538B4B6AF9DC63AD16947364AF881E3EB45DB91CCEBD4A9040E7ABAAA5580221009169EB81CA5C7CB675CCB802761402B7D0997956F7F89BBD417571774202708B

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

00DBFE87EA6849C5F8B1BA80178A363FBE7A4DFA7B449FF0B58ED701BE5A92C4E0

Coordinator signature

6976023EB1AF9415F0D6EA53320D233C003D8B1C6A19BCF924549780F5B2C3001A79E40AD8B6D3ACDEAC5C4F6A3948F873DF84B710C87C33A785C1C51EF4EE07

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

5A1AF218EDA2CB4F9B17862EF023654280379907273A365792ADCDDF4D7648308D7193F2BF0C89492B888E6331984DF06CF0D2A334D7A8EE4DAAB2888241C008

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

9B6FD42ABC606766806463BB29462CBF7DABD565B77A4B0E4B7E9DF101D843BD93902BFD1DB37BCF3D39C71B46F6D23B624BCC5B63FB8BFBE88EFC6EE4BD8002